"So banks the fate at the door," to Beethoven once have said to explain the theme from the first beat of its 5. Symphony. These are some of the most famous which have been composed, and is often used to give the definition of classical music. With a contemporary fanfare for brass players, portrayed ironic over just this fateful theme of the young Danish composer Jesper Koch. On a somewhat more cheerfully show included the fate of the thread up in the Overture to the Carl Nielsen's Maskarade opera. Sibelius Valse Triste, melancholy with their look back at a long life, is followed by the thundering the Overture to the Opera twist of fate the power of value. So goes the fate theme from Beethoven's 5th the Symphony throughout the concert.

Our very own alternating solobratsjist Kjell Åge Stoveland is an emcee and makes sure to tie the fate of the threads further along. We also have the pleasure to introduce a new acquaintance, Danish conductor Maria Sauna. This is a concert for any major thoughts and feelings!

Symphonic Saturday is a concert series with the matinékonserter of shorter duration, and with more accessible music, suitable for families with children and strange konsertgjengere.
